The Ghanaian Parliament is reportedly considering a bill to legalize cryptocurrency, addressing unregulated usage amid reports of high local adoption, but confirmation of approval remains elusive…
The move signals Ghana’s intent to regulate the burgeoning crypto market, with potential implications for local financial systems and investor dynamics despite a lack of official enactment confirmation.
